About Orna
The surname Orna is of Hebrew origin and has multiple meanings. In Hebrew, "Orna" means "pine tree" or "fir tree." It can also be derived from the Hebrew word "Ornan," which means "light" or "enlightenment." Additionally, Orna can be a variant of the name Orne, which is derived from the Old English word "orn," meaning "eagle." Overall, the surname Orna is associated with nature, light, and strength.
